F22A/0125 is a planning application for permission at Ketelby Mews, 40 Howth Road, Sutton, Dublin 13, D13 C3F2, received by Fingal County Council on 1 Sept 2022 and first seen by Planning Register on 11 Sept 2026. The application describes: The development will consist of a) the sub divison of the subject site… The council granted permission on 28 Sept 2022. The five-week observation window closed on 6 Oct 2022. An Coimisiún Pleanála decided appeal 314936 on 28 Jun 2023 (grant conditions). A commencement notice (CN0114179FL) was lodged on 23 Apr 2024, so works have started on site. The site is zoned null under the Fingal County Council development plan. Within 500 m there are 55 other decided applications in the last five years and 8 appeals.

RS - Residential: Provide for residential development and protect and improve residential amenity

An established residential area. The objective is to protect existing residential amenity as well as to provide housing — which is the objective a neighbour's objection to an overbearing extension is usually argued under.
